"sample assessment" is a correct and usable phrase in written English.
It is typically used to refer to a test or evaluation that is given as a representative example for students to practice or to demonstrate a particular skill or concept. An example sentence using this phrase could be: "The teacher handed out a sample assessment for the students to complete before taking the actual exam."
